Find methods information, sources, references or conduct a literature review on ... WebBismuth was first used many years ago! The Incas combined this metal with copper and tin to produce knives and in Ancient Egypt, bismoclite was often used for cosmetic purposes. However, industrial production of the metal did not begin until around 1830. Today, bismuth is found in an application that is very useful to our local heroes.
